How they compare
Ukraine currently reports 88.3% against 83.0% in India, a difference of 5.3%.
That makes Ukraine's figure about 1.1 times India's.
Across all 25 years both countries report, Ukraine has been ahead every year.
India ranks 38th and Ukraine ranks 35th of 105 countries.
Ukraine has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| India | Ukraine |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 70.3% | 93.5% | 23.2% | Ukraine |
| 2010s | 76.7% | 89.1% | 12.4% | Ukraine |
| 2020s | 81.6% | 88.3% | 6.7% | Ukraine |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
